Imprint Films has announced their June 2025 Blu-ray lineup and this thing is stacked, including two films from Martin Scoresse along with two that are making their Blu-ray debuts.
Each of these releases streets on June 25th, 2025
Each of these releases streets on June 25th, 2025
0 Comments